Toast walnuts in a naked skillet. Set aside.
-
Whisk together four, turmeric, baking soda, and table salt.
-
Cream butter and sugars together until well combined.
-
Beat in vanilla.
-
Add eggs one at a time. Ensure the first is completely incorporated into the batter before adding the second.
-
Turn the mixer speed down to low and slowly add the flour until it is combined.
-
Fold in chips and toasted walnuts.
-
Wrap the batter in plastic cling film. Chill for 2 hours.
-
Preheat oven to 375F. Line 2 baking sheets with parchment paper.
-
Form balls and place them on the baking sheet.
-
Top with a few flakes of salt.
-
-
Transfer to cooling racks.
-
Plate and serve.
